Title III of the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) is being understood to include websites as “places of public accommodation”. This includes your company’s website presence. It may not be your intent but if your website has inaccessible aspects to it you might be exposing your business to fines and/or lawsuits. People with disabilities can view this is discriminatory against people like them and other persons with disabilities and based on that perspective your company’s website might be in violation of Title III of the ADA Act.
